Skip to content

Commit

Permalink
Update documentation
Browse files Browse the repository at this point in the history
  • Loading branch information
gaow committed Aug 17, 2023
1 parent dfaa231 commit f30ad7f
Show file tree
Hide file tree
Showing 7 changed files with 296 additions and 327 deletions.
2 changes: 1 addition & 1 deletion README.html
Original file line number Diff line number Diff line change
Expand Up @@ -715,7 +715,7 @@ <h3>Organization of the resource<a class="headerlink" href="#organization-of-the
<div class="section" id="computing-environment-setup">
<h3>Computing environment setup<a class="headerlink" href="#computing-environment-setup" title="Permalink to this headline"></a></h3>
<ul class="simple">
<li><p>In order to run the xQTL protocol on your computer (or a High Performance Computing cluster), please install Script of Scripts <a class="reference external" href="https://wanggroup.org/orientation/jupyter-setup">(see here for a tutorial to set it up with <code class="docutils literal notranslate"><span class="pre">micromamba</span></code>)</a>.</p>
<li><p>In order to run the xQTL protocol on your computer (or a High Performance Computing cluster), please install Script of Scripts (<strong>version &gt; 0.24.1</strong>) <a class="reference external" href="https://wanggroup.org/orientation/jupyter-setup">(see here for a tutorial to set it up with <code class="docutils literal notranslate"><span class="pre">micromamba</span></code>)</a>.</p>
<ul>
<li><p>For Linux and Mac desktop users you can either install the container <a class="reference external" href="https://docs.sylabs.io/guides/3.2/user-guide/installation.html"><code class="docutils literal notranslate"><span class="pre">Singularity</span></code></a> or <a class="reference external" href="https://www.docker.com/"><code class="docutils literal notranslate"><span class="pre">Docker</span></code></a>. In the xQTL project we primarily use <code class="docutils literal notranslate"><span class="pre">Singularity</span></code>.</p></li>
<li><p>For Linux-based HPC users, your system may already have <code class="docutils literal notranslate"><span class="pre">Singularity</span></code> installed. If not please communicate with the IT support for the HPC. Typically Docker is not allowed on HPC.</p></li>
Expand Down
2 changes: 1 addition & 1 deletion _sources/README.md
Original file line number Diff line number Diff line change
Expand Up @@ -39,7 +39,7 @@ The website https://cumc.github.io/xqtl-pipeline is generated from files under t

### Computing environment setup

- In order to run the xQTL protocol on your computer (or a High Performance Computing cluster), please install Script of Scripts [(see here for a tutorial to set it up with `micromamba`)](https://wanggroup.org/orientation/jupyter-setup).
- In order to run the xQTL protocol on your computer (or a High Performance Computing cluster), please install Script of Scripts (**version > 0.24.1**) [(see here for a tutorial to set it up with `micromamba`)](https://wanggroup.org/orientation/jupyter-setup).
- For Linux and Mac desktop users you can either install the container [`Singularity`](https://docs.sylabs.io/guides/3.2/user-guide/installation.html#) or [`Docker`](https://www.docker.com/). In the xQTL project we primarily use `Singularity`.
- For Linux-based HPC users, your system may already have `Singularity` installed. If not please communicate with the IT support for the HPC. Typically Docker is not allowed on HPC.
- For Windows users, you will need to install [WSL](https://learn.microsoft.com/en-us/windows/wsl/install) (we have tested it on WSL2 and not on WSL1) and then install `Singularity` within WSL as instructed in this [post](https://www.blopig.com/blog/2021/09/using-singularity-on-windows-with-wsl2/).
Expand Down
53 changes: 26 additions & 27 deletions _sources/code/data_preprocessing/genotype/VCF_QC.ipynb
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@
"cells": [
{
"cell_type": "markdown",
"id": "acquired-queen",
"id": "noted-verse",
"metadata": {
"kernel": "SoS",
"tags": []
Expand All @@ -13,7 +13,7 @@
},
{
"cell_type": "markdown",
"id": "authentic-railway",
"id": "reported-modeling",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-23,7 +23,7 @@
},
{
"cell_type": "markdown",
"id": "peripheral-zimbabwe",
"id": "engaging-brisbane",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-46,7 +46,7 @@
},
{
"cell_type": "markdown",
"id": "competent-antarctica",
"id": "empirical-intention",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-69,7 +69,7 @@
},
{
"cell_type": "markdown",
"id": "perceived-chicken",
"id": "limited-induction",
"metadata": {
"kernel": "SoS",
"tags": []
Expand All @@ -94,7 +94,7 @@
},
{
"cell_type": "markdown",
"id": "entertaining-christmas",
"id": "acting-tuning",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-112,7 +112,7 @@
},
{
"cell_type": "markdown",
"id": "coral-genealogy",
"id": "rotary-dodge",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-134,7 +134,7 @@
},
{
"cell_type": "markdown",
"id": "comparative-welcome",
"id": "ranking-schedule",
"metadata": {
"kernel": "SoS"
},
Expand Down Expand Up @@ -177,7 +177,7 @@
},
{
"cell_type": "markdown",
"id": "foreign-intermediate",
"id": "young-negative",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-192,7 +192,7 @@
{
"cell_type": "code",
"execution_count": 13,
"id": "local-lending",
"id": "present-potential",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-211,7 +211,7 @@
},
{
"cell_type": "markdown",
"id": "infinite-estonia",
"id": "attempted-protein",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-222,7 +222,7 @@
{
"cell_type": "code",
"execution_count": 4,
"id": "surrounded-tyler",
"id": "aggressive-necessity",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-241,7 +241,7 @@
},
{
"cell_type": "markdown",
"id": "liked-radar",
"id": "documentary-importance",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-252,7 +252,7 @@
{
"cell_type": "code",
"execution_count": null,
"id": "broad-satin",
"id": "contemporary-spyware",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-264,7 +264,7 @@
},
{
"cell_type": "markdown",
"id": "occasional-firewall",
"id": "certified-strap",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-275,7 +275,7 @@
{
"cell_type": "code",
"execution_count": 1,
"id": "banner-simon",
"id": "sitting-princess",
"metadata": {
"kernel": "Bash",
"tags": []
Expand Down Expand Up @@ -374,7 +374,7 @@
},
{
"cell_type": "markdown",
"id": "altered-fountain",
"id": "dutch-advocate",
"metadata": {
"kernel": "Bash"
},
Expand All @@ -385,7 +385,7 @@
{
"cell_type": "code",
"execution_count": null,
"id": "recent-score",
"id": "interstate-building",
"metadata": {
"kernel": "SoS"
},
Expand Down Expand Up @@ -469,7 +469,7 @@
},
{
"cell_type": "markdown",
"id": "dynamic-halloween",
"id": "alpha-enhancement",
"metadata": {
"kernel": "SoS",
"tags": []
Expand All @@ -485,7 +485,7 @@
{
"cell_type": "code",
"execution_count": null,
"id": "sharp-peninsula",
"id": "wound-physiology",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-506,7 +506,7 @@
{
"cell_type": "code",
"execution_count": null,
"id": "stylish-trust",
"id": "progressive-vacuum",
"metadata": {
"kernel": "SoS"
},
Expand Down Expand Up @@ -537,7 +537,7 @@
},
{
"cell_type": "markdown",
"id": "stuck-orleans",
"id": "representative-college",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-550,7 +550,7 @@
{
"cell_type": "code",
"execution_count": 4,
"id": "reported-reaction",
"id": "baking-liberal",
"metadata": {
"kernel": "SoS"
},
Expand Down Expand Up @@ -598,7 +598,7 @@
},
{
"cell_type": "markdown",
"id": "answering-brooklyn",
"id": "hidden-superior",
"metadata": {
"kernel": "SoS"
},
Expand All @@ -609,7 +609,7 @@
{
"cell_type": "code",
"execution_count": 3,
"id": "affiliated-anchor",
"id": "textile-keyboard",
"metadata": {
"kernel": "SoS"
},
Expand Down Expand Up @@ -675,14 +675,13 @@
{
"cell_type": "code",
"execution_count": null,
"id": "little-planet",
"id": "fluid-legislature",
"metadata": {
"kernel": "SoS"
},
"outputs": [],
"source": [
"[qc_3 (genotype data summary statistics)]\n",
"parameter: walltime = '24h'\n",
"input: output_from('qc_1'), output_from('qc_2'), group_by = 1\n",
"output: f\"{cwd}/{_input:bnn}.novel_variant_sumstats\", \n",
" f\"{cwd}/{_input:bnn}.known_variant_sumstats\", \n",
Expand Down
Loading

0 comments on commit f30ad7f

Please sign in to comment.